How Life Works Here
Dunraven Street is located in City of Westminster, Greater London. Crime is a significant concern, with 1799 incidents recorded in 12 months — well above the national average. Theft from the person dominates reports. This level of crime reflects a high-footfall transport hub rather than a typical residential street. Some amenities are available nearby, though a car may be useful for regular errands like grocery shopping. The closest is an ATM at 50m. The nearest transport stop is 38m away (bus and tram). Rail links may require a connecting journey. The median property price is £2,675,000, though prices have fallen 78% over five years. Based on 19 transactions recorded since 2014. Rented accommodation predominates. There are 8 schools within 2 km, 8 rated Good or Outstanding by Ofsted. 4 are rated Outstanding. Both primary and secondary options are available locally. However, high local crime rates are a serious concern for families with children, regardless of school proximity. Some market indicators point to a cooling trend. Overall, this street scores 51 out of 100 for liveability. Note that the composite score masks a serious safety concern that may outweigh other strengths for many residents.
